UV germicidal lamp why choose quartz tube instead of Teflon.

In UV germicidal lamps, quartz tubes and Teflon materials each have different optical and physical properties. Quartz tubes are often chosen as the protective housing for UV germicidal lamps rather than Teflon, mainly because quartz has better UV transmittance and heat resistance. Here are a few key reasons to choose a quartz tube over Teflon:

 

1. Ultraviolet transmittance

Quartz tube: The permeability of quartz glass to ultraviolet rays, especially UVC (200-280 nm) is very high, usually up to more than 90%. This high transmittance is a key feature of UV germicidal lamps, as it ensures that more UV rays can effectively reach the target area, thus achieving a stronger germicidal effect.

 

Teflon: Although Teflon has a certain permeability to some bands of ultraviolet light, its permeability to UVC is much lower than that of quartz. This means that using Teflon as a housing material significantly reduces the intensity of the UV output, which reduces the bactericidal effectiveness.

 

2. Heat resistance

Quartz tube: Quartz has extremely high heat resistance and can withstand high temperatures without deformation or deterioration. Uv lamps generate a lot of heat when working, and quartz is able to maintain its structure and optical properties, ensuring the stable operation of the lamps.

 

Teflon: Teflon is better at heat resistance, but still worse than quartz. Under high temperature conditions, Teflon may deform or age, which may affect the life and performance of the luminaire.

 

3. Chemical stability

Quartz tube: Quartz has a very high tolerance to most chemicals and is not prone to chemical reactions. Uv germicidal lamps may react with oxygen in the air to produce ozone when working, and the chemical stability of quartz can avoid adverse reactions with these reactive substances to ensure the long-term use of the lamp.

 

Teflon: Although Teflon also has good chemical stability, it may release harmful substances under certain extreme conditions (such as decomposition at ultra-high temperatures). Therefore, quartz is still the safer choice.

 

4. Optical cleanliness

Quartz tube: The optical properties of quartz material allow it to achieve extremely high purity and transparency in the manufacturing process. This helps to maximize the transmission efficiency of ultraviolet light and ensure the effectiveness of the germicidal lamp.

 

Teflon: The manufacturing process of Teflon can result in unevenly distributed microstructure inside the material, which can affect the transmission of ultraviolet light, resulting in the scattering and reflection of light, thereby reducing the efficiency of the luminaire.

 

conclusion

The application of quartz tube in ultraviolet germicidal lamp has the following significant advantages:

* High UV transmittance, especially in the UVC band, ensures maximum bactericidal effect.

* Excellent heat resistance and chemical stability, suitable for long-term use in high temperatures and complex environments.

* With high optical purity, can effectively transmit ultraviolet rays.

 

In contrast, while Teflon performs well in some applications, in UV germicidal lamps, the optical and physical properties of quartz tubes are more suitable for this application, so quartz tubes are often chosen as the housing material for lamps.
